    Abstract: The present disclosure provides an event stream processing system, comprises a gateway device and an external module. The gateway device comprises an event processing engine, and the external module comprises external processor. The event processing engine comprises an event grouping unit, a catch-collector, a processor and an event generator. The event processing engine processes a plurality events of the event stream corresponded to a rule. The event grouping unit groups the events corresponded to the rule. The catch-collector couples to the event group unit, configured for storing a first group event. The processor couples to the event group unit, configured for processing a second group event. The external module calculates the first group event and generates a first processing result. The event generator integrates the first processing result of the first group event and a second processing result of the second group event and generates a derived event.

    Abstract: An electronic apparatus includes a selection unit, a storage unit and a processing unit. The selection unit and the storage unit are coupled to the processing unit. The selection unit selects a first reference point proximate to the electronic apparatus. The storage unit stores a plurality of second locations of a plurality of second reference points. The processing unit executes a single-point distance measurement between the electronic apparatus and a first location of the selected first reference point, provides the electronic apparatus auxiliary positioning information by selecting the second locations stored in the storage unit and generates a speculative location of the electronic apparatus by further computing the results of the single-point distance measurement and the auxiliary positioning information.
